Rodents consume and contaminate up to 20% of global food reserves annually while serving as vectors for Leptospirosis and Hantavirus. We manufacture highly appetizing, moisture-resistant second-generation anticoagulant rodenticides (SGARs), such as Brodifacoum 0.005% bait blocks, gels, and treated grains, engineered for complete colony elimination through slow-acting delayed mortality.
In hospital, hospitality, and food processing environments, zero-pest-tolerance mandates call for non-repellent, low-toxicity chemical chemistries. Products utilizing Indoxacarb 0.05% Bait and Thiamethoxam 1% + Tricosene bait matrix exploit social grooming and cannibalistic behavior in synanthropic pests (cockroaches and flies), driving domino-effect extermination within harbourages.
As active ingredient resistance mechanisms (such as kdr mutations and metabolic detoxification via cytochrome P450 enzymes) escalate globally, traditional pesticide formulations face diminishing field efficiency. Awiner Biotech's R&D division focuses on advanced physical delivery systems, synergistic co-formulations, and targeted MoA (Mechanism of Action) rotation.
Transitioning away from high-VOC emulsifiable concentrates (EC) toward environmentally benign Emulsions in Water (EW) and Microencapsulated Suspensions (CS). Microencapsulation slows active ingredient degradation against UV radiation and high environmental ambient temperatures, extending residual activity on porous concrete and timber surfaces from weeks to months.
Combining Type I/II Synthetic Pyrethroids (e.g., Permethrin + Cypermethrin EW) or combining adulticides with Insect Growth Regulators (IGRs) disrupts metamorphic lifecycles. Co-formulating attractant pheromones (e.g., Z-9-Tricosene with Thiamethoxam) lowers the required active chemical dosage while multiplying vector contact frequency.
Rodent block baits utilize food-grade paraffin wax matrix integration with high-purity grain blends to resist ambient moisture in tropical, high-humidity, and subterranean sewer environments. The following comparative guide outlines chemical active properties, targeted vector spectrums, and formulation formats engineered at the Awiner Biotech chemical plant:
| Active Ingredient / Product Name | CAS Reg. No. | Formulation Type | Target Pest Spectrum | Primary Mode of Action (MoA) |
|---|---|---|---|---|
| Brodifacoum | 56073-10-0 | 0.005% Bait Block, Gel, Grain | Synanthropic Rodents (Mice, Rats) | Second-generation anticoagulant (Inhibits Vitamin K1 epoxide reductase) |
| Thiamethoxam + Tricosene | 153719-23-4 | 1% + 0.1% Attractant Bait | Musca domestica (Houseflies) | Neonicotinoid (nAChR agonist) combined with sex pheromone lure |
| Temephos | 3383-96-8 | 1% Sand Granule (SG) | Mosquito Larvae (Aedes, Anopheles) | Organophosphate acetylcholinesterase (AChE) inhibitor |
| Propoxur | 114-26-1 | 1.5% Bait Granule | Cockroaches, Crawling Insects | Carbamate rapid knockdown neurotoxin (Reversible AChE inhibitor) |
| Phoxim | 14816-18-3 | 50% EC Liquid | Public Health & Agricultural Pests | Organophosphate contact & stomach poison with fast residual activity |
| Permethrin + Cypermethrin | 52645-53-1 / 71697-59-1 | 500g/L EC / 0.3%+0.3% EW | Mosquitoes, Flies, Bedbugs, Fleas | Synthetic Pyrethroid (Voltage-gated sodium channel modulator) |
| Indoxacarb | 144171-61-9 | 0.05% Cockroach Bait Gel | Blattella germanica, Periplaneta | Oxadiazine sodium channel blocker (Bioactivated by insect enzymes) |
| Imidacloprid | 138261-41-3 | 35% SC / 2% Granule (GR) | Termites, Ants, Soil & Vector Insects | Systemic Neonicotinoid targeting central nervous system receptors |
